Table of ContentsAcknowledgements Chapter One - Introduction: New Post-binary Sexualities and Genders for a Digital Era Chapter Two - New Identity Labels: Towards a New Sexual and Gender Taxonomy Chapter Three - Expanding the Range: Grids, Matrices and the Role of Gender and Relationships Chapter Four - Identity Citizenship: Authenticity, Intersectionality and a New Populism Chapter Five - Queer Choice: Sexuality and the Emerging Discourses of Choosing and Changing Chapter Six - New Heterosexualities: Digital Media and an Adaptable Heteromasculinity Chapter Seven - Implications: What Do Emergent Identities Do?
